Home
last modified time | relevance | path

Searched defs:LaneBitmask (Results 1 – 2 of 2) sorted by relevance

/llvm-project/llvm/include/llvm/MC/
H A DLaneBitmask.h40 struct LaneBitmask { struct
46 constexpr LaneBitmask() = default; argument
47 explicit constexpr LaneBitmask(Type V) : Mask(V) {} in LaneBitmask() argument
56 constexpr LaneBitmask operator~() const { argument
81 static constexpr LaneBitmask getNone() { return LaneBitmask(0); } in getNone() argument
82 static constexpr LaneBitmask getAll() { return ~LaneBitmask(0); } in getAll() argument
83 static constexpr LaneBitmask getLane(unsigned Lane) { in getLane() argument
/llvm-project/llvm/include/llvm/CodeGen/
H A DTargetRegisterInfo.h752 composeSubRegIndexLaneMaskImpl(unsigned,LaneBitmask) composeSubRegIndexLaneMaskImpl() argument
756 reverseComposeSubRegIndexLaneMaskImpl(unsigned,LaneBitmask) reverseComposeSubRegIndexLaneMaskImpl() argument
[all...]